Good vs Evil supports single player, co-operative and player vs player, and will scale according to the number and level of players taking part in the battle.
Take command of an army in an epic battle between good and evil, with up to a hundred soldiers on the battlefield at any one time!
Choose a side. Choose an army. Choose a battlefield.
Give orders to your troops, summon reinforcements and deploy artillery to support them as your army strives to capture the enemy's shrines, smash down the gates of their fortress and destroy their altar.
Wage war alone against the computer, or take the battle online and fight alongside (or against!) your friends.
It's your war now - fight it the way you want to.
Good vs Evil was first released in the summer of 2003. This major new update includes a host of new features, gameplay tweaks and bug fixes, including -
Hero Mode - Play as a Hero instead of a General, leaving the AI to command your army for you while you knock some heads together.
Campaign Mode - Why settle for a single battle when you can fight an entire war? Each victory takes you deeper into enemy territory, each defeat brings your side closer to annihilation.
Prepare For Battle - Design your own unique weapons and armour to suit your needs, or brighten up old equipment with a new look, a different colour scheme or fresh magical enhancements.
New Battlefields - Fight in the snow and ice of a harsh frontier winter, in the blazing heat of the desert, or in lava-filled tunnels.
Improved AI - The enemy is now more intelligent, more aggressive and more challenging on higher difficulty settings, and more forgiving on lower ones.
Modify The Mod - Good vs Evil II comes with a step-by-step guide explaining how you can add your own new soldiers, armies and battlefields to the mod.
And Much, Much More - Good vs Evil has been balanced, tweaked and expanded based on three years of feedback, suggestions and bug reports from the mod's fans...
v2.04 now available with support for designing your own cloaks, as well as fixes for a few bugs. This version requires NWN v1.68 and both expansion packs.

OMG, give this mod to an old wargamer who likes NwN (like me), and you will have him entertained a lot of hours :D
A pity that the campaign is so short (only 3 battles to win, -unless you change sides, like a good mercenary ^^-), and that the system is not so completely developed as to place tactical objectives different to the mana points, to design wide operations as branches of the war, to allocate resources for specific scenarios in a campaign...) but I think that would be to ask too much.
Perfect as it is to have long hours of fun (superb for multiplayer), and a very grateful surprise to find such a thing around here :)
